首页 / 智能硬件 / 正文

FPGA生成方波信号

时间:2024-10-04 07:00:34

fpga生成方波 

在FPGA中生成方波的方法有以下几种:

1. 使用周期性计数器:设置一个计数器,每次计数器计数完成后,输出一个高电平或低电平。这种方法可以产生固定频率的方波。

2. 使用DDS(数字相位锁相器)模块:通过调节相位和频率的参数来产生不同的方波。这种方法可以产生固定采样率的方波。

3. 使用CORDIC(Coordinate Rotation Digital Computer)算法:通过旋转坐标轴来产生正弦波和余弦波,然后通过改变幅度和相位来产生其他类型的方波。

4. 使用翻转IO口:定义1bit的数据,按照一定的时间周期,对此数据赋值0和1,就可以得到方波。最简单的做法是直接把时钟信号输出到一个IO口即可看到方波输出。

需要注意的是,生成方波的频率受限于FPGA的输入频率源。可以通过计数器或者DDS模块来实现不同频率的方波,但可能无法实现任意频率的方波。

《FPGA生成方波信号》不代表本网站观点,如有侵权请联系我们删除

抖十三数码科技 广州小漏斗信息技术有限公司 版权所有 粤ICP备20006251号